Moulin Rouge! The Musical Tickets & Information
Vieux Moulin! The Musical, adapted by the 2001 movie by Baz Luhrmann, is an impressive play that has won hearts of people worldwide. It is a mix of romance, rebellion, and colorful tapestry of pop music to take the spectators to the luxurious world of the famous nightclub of Paris. The performance received ten Tony Awards including the category of Best Musical.
Information on Tickets:
- New York Broadway: Performances take place in the Al Hirschfeld Theatre. The tickets can be purchased at Broadway Direct and Broadway.com, with the starting price of 68.36 dollars.
- The play is performed in the Piccadilly Theatre in the West End of London. The prices begin at 25 and can be bought on the official ATG box office.
- Tours on the Road: The musical is also stopping by other destinations. The official Moulin Rouge! site contains all the latest updates regarding the tour, dates and prices of tickets.
Information about the Performance:
- Duration: approximately 2 hours 35 minutes with 20 minutes in the middle.
- Warning: Weapons can be displayed onstage, and the show can contain upsetting visuals or auditory such as strobe lights, fog, or loud fringe.
- Age Recommendation: 12 years and above; no child under 4 is permitted.
Ambassador Theatre
Ambassador Theatre is a historic Broadway theatre that has a glorious past and architectural significance and is located at 219 West 49th Street in the Theatre District in New York City. Herbert J. Krapp, the architect of the theatre, designed it and was opened to the audience on the 11th of February 1921 by the Shubert Organisation. It should be noted that the Ambassador auditorium is a landmark of New York City. The theatre was positioned diagonally on its small plot to obtain the maximum seating and its unusual hexagonal design and Adam-style decoration has made it a household name.
The Ambassador Theatre has hosted everything, including early operettas and long-running musicals. Since January 29, 2003, it has been the home of the critically acclaimed musical Chicago. It has turned out to be the longest-running American musical in Broadway.
Visitors may use the C, E or 1 underground line to 50 th Street to reach the Ambassador Theatre. The nearest bus stations are 7th Ave/W. 50th St. and 8th Ave/W. 49th St. The nearby parking garages are Zenith Parking Garage at 254 West 49th Street, and Redball Parking LLC at 225 West 49th Street.

August Wilson Theatre
The August Wilson Theatre is a legendary theatre located in the Theatre District of New York City and is positioned at 245 West 52nd Street, with a rich history of hosting the most prestigious theatrical plays in the world. The theatre has had numerous names since it opened in 1925 as the Guild Theatre to its renaming in 2005 in honour of the famous playwright August Wilson. ANTA Theatre (1950), Virginia Theatre (1981) and recently, August Wilson Theatre.
Location Summary
- The number of seats is approximately 1,225, which is split into the orchestra and mezzanine levels.
- The theatre is designed like a 15th century Tuscan house. It is stuccoed on the outside with quoins on the windows and the doors to maintain the original style.
- This facility has seating accommodations of individuals with mobility problems, visual or hearing impairments. Customers with mobility issues can be serviced through a stair lift which links directly between the front of the theatre and the Orchestra level.
Barrymore Theatre
The Ethel Barrymore Theatre is a highly regarded Broadway theatre that has a rich and illustrious history and is located at 243 West 47 th Street in the Theatre District of New York City. Ethel Barrymore Theatre is an architectural masterpiece designed by Herbert J. Krapp and named after the great actress Ethel Barrymore; it was opened to the masses on December 20, 1928. This theatre was built by the Shubert Organisation on behalf of one of its affiliated actors and it is the only theatre of its type left. Some of the well-known plays that have been staged in the theatre include The Curious Incident of the Dog in the Night-Time, A Streetcar Named Desire, The Glass Menagerie and The Band s Visit. It is still loved by theatregoers because of its intimate space and beautiful architecture in the Beaux-Arts style.
Belasco Theatre
The Belasco Theatre is one of the most prestigious theatre districts in New York City, having been delighting the Broadway audience with its cozy interior and an excellent history over the generations. The theatre, which was originally called the Stuyvesant Theatre, was renamed in 1910 in honor of the late David Belasco, a powerful promoter who had a part in the concept and the creation of the theatre. Many of Belasco theatrical relics were stored in a Gothic-style duplex where he resided above the theatre. The theater has gained a lot of fame with its elaborate Neo-Georgian architecture that features paintings and plasterwork by an artist known as Everett Shinn. Due to its small capacity (1,016 people), the Belasco Theatre is more intimate with its visitors.
